Luton Made: Vauxhall

From the factory floor to the design studio, and the thousands who passed through the gates each day, this project tells the story of Vauxhall Motors through the voices of those who lived it.

Take a walk round Stockwood Discovery Centre to take in this real piece of Luton history.
